How do I make before-and-after videos with AI?
Short answer
Anchor the first frame as the "before" state and the last frame as the "after" state, then let the AI generate a satisfying transformation transition between them.
Recommended mode: DirectorScenario: Home renovation, beauty, fitness, and product transformation content for ads and social proof.
Execution Steps
- 1Capture or select a clear "before" image and a polished "after" image from the same angle.
- 2Set the before image as the opening anchor frame and the after image as the closing anchor.
- 3Generate a smooth transformation transition — wipe reveal, gradual morph, or time-lapse style.
- 4Add context text overlays showing the timeline and key changes for viewer clarity.
Prompt Template
Create a 10-second before-and-after transformation video. Use frame A as the starting state and frame B as the final state. Apply a smooth time-lapse morph transition.
Common Failure Points
- Using before and after photos taken from different angles or lighting conditions
- Making the transition too fast for viewers to appreciate the change
- Forgetting to add context about what changed and how long it took
